What do you guys think? Is the Ushio bulb worth the $70 that it costs v. the Catalina @ $25? I know Kracker G is using the Catlaina bulb w/o any problems, but does anyone else have experience? Any PAR readings to justify the almost 2.5x increase in price for the Ushio?

I've used two of the catalina 70 watters. The first one crapped out on me (but I later learned that it was due to a faulty ballast connection, however, in frustration, I broke the bulb on accident).

 

My second experience with the Catalina 70 watter is going underway currently. I've had one running for almost a month, no problems. It seems like PSL tested the bulb before I bought it, since it had a little burned in ring (I guess this means that they are testing for duds before they sell em.)

 

So, it's up to you. I still think buying Catalina products is risky.

 

PAR wise, I haven't a clue.

This is my first MH but it seems really yellow. I am going to have to supplement with serious actinic. I understand that the AQ bulb is blu enough that you do not need blue bulbs run with it. So I saved on the bulb but in the end it will cost more.

But it is a great excuse to run an extra 63 watts of light!
